  • 1

    The study identified independent risk factors for in-hospital heart failure in T2DM patients post-PCI for STEMI.

  • 2

    Seven independent risk factors were found, including prior myocardial infarction and smoking history.

  • 3

    A nomogram was developed based on these risk factors, showing an AUC of 0.845 for predictive capability.

  • 4

    The model demonstrated good calibration with a Hosmer-Lemeshow test result of P=0.712.

  • 5

    External validation of the nomogram is needed before clinical application in diverse settings.
